#5e0215 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5e0215 is composed of 36.9% red, 0.8%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.9% magenta, 77.7%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 347.6 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 18.8%. #5e0215 color hex could be obtained by blending #bc042a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

● #5e0215 color description : Very dark red.
#5e0215 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5e0215 has RGB values of R:94, G:2,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.78,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 6160917.

Shades and Tints of #5e0215
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110004 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5e0215
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#322e2f is the less saturated color, while #5e0215 is the most saturated one.
